Germany sent 23 citizens of Azerbaijan

23 Azerbaijani citizens were returned from Germany on November 30 as part of an agreement between Azerbaijan and the EU on the reacts of citizens living without permission, the State Migration Service of Azerbaijan said.

The reception process was carried out in the manner prescribed by the operational headquarters in the office of ministers in connection with the pandemia of coronavirus.

The message notes that the working group for reintegration takes measures to solve possible difficulties that returned citizens may encounter.

According to the State Migration Service, after the signing of the Realday Agreement between Azerbaijan and the EU in 2014, 2013 citizens were returned to Azerbaijan until the end of 2021, 420 of them last year.
